1963 Ford Cortina vs. 2011 Bentley Continental GTC
To start off, 2011 Bentley Continental GTC is newer by 48 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1963 Ford Cortina.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1963 Ford Cortina would be higher. At 5,998 cc (12 cylinders), 2011 Bentley Continental GTC is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2011 Bentley Continental GTC (552 HP) has 503 more horse power than 1963 Ford Cortina. (49 HP) In normal driving conditions, 2011 Bentley Continental GTC should accelerate faster than 1963 Ford Cortina.
Because 2011 Bentley Continental GTC is all wheel drive (AWD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1963 Ford Cortina.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2011 Bentley Continental GTC will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2011 Bentley Continental GTC (650 Nm) has 560 more torque (in Nm) than 1963 Ford Cortina. (90 Nm). This means 2011 Bentley Continental GTC will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1963 Ford Cortina.
